The registration process allows to retrieve by name some information about a specific class from a centralized point. The current version of the class register allows to: - Create dynamically an object based on a name provided as a string. This feature is required for the deserialization process (from a buffer and a name, create a new object of a given type defined by a string). - Modify the logging level of detail for a given class. See cmnLogger for more details regarding the logging in cisst. Since the dynamic creation requires a base class, we have introduced the cmnGenericObject class in cisstCommon. One can only register classes derived from cmnGenericObject. The registration requires the use of #CMN_DECLARE_SERVICES (or #CMN_DECLARE_SERVICES_EXPORT), #CMN_DECLARE_SERVICES_INSTANTIATION (or #CMN_DECLARE_SERVICES_INSTANTIATION_EXPORT) and #CMN_IMPLEMENT_SERVICES (or #CMN_IMPLEMENT_SERVICES_TEMPLATED). Here are the details of the implementation. The macro #CMN_DECLARE_SERVICES defines a method called Services() for each registered class. This method returns a pointer on a static data member of type cmnClassServices. This cmnClassServices object is unique for that class. While the reasons for writing a method which returns a pointer on a static data member might seem confusing, they are actually quite simple. This method is used to ensure that the data member is initialized the first time it is used. This is done to avoid problems related to the order of instantiation of the static data members when used before main(). When the Services() method defined in the #CMN_IMPLEMENT_SERVICES macro is called, the cmnClassServices object registers itself within static class register. This allows us to keep a single list of all the classes that exist in a particular program. The register is implemented as a map of pointers to the cmnClassServices objects that exist. It is important to note that all classes to be registered will be registered by the time the main() function is called.
